Here’s To 8,000, And To 8,000 More
Tonight’s game against the Miami Marlins will be the 8,000th regular season game in Mets franchise history. The Mets are have a won-loss record of 3829-4162 with eight ties in their history going into tonight. Johan Santana will take the mound as millions of Mets fans will dream the impossible dream – a Mets no-hitter. Mets News: Chris Young Tosses Five Scoreless Innings
Chris Young tossed five scoreless innings tonight as St. Lucie beat Brevard County 4-3. It was his first official minor league game since undergoing May 16, 2011 surgery to repair a torn anterior capsule in his right shoulder. Young allowed five hits and two walks while striking out four batters. Young is expected to make 3-4 more minor league starts at a higher level before joining the Mets rotation sometime in June.
